HOW YOU’LL MAKE AN IMPACT:
The incumbent in this position partners with the Category Management team to achieve the overall financial and strategic objectives of the organization. The Planning Manager manages the financial performance of the merchandise and optimizes assortment placement and quantification.

45%:
Merchandise Financial Planning

  • Develop and execute merchandise financial plans by product classification aligned to financial targets to establish annual budgets and open-to-buy
  • In partnership with the Category Manager, establish assortment strategies (pricing, buy quantities, commodity blends) to achieve the financial plans
  • In partnership with the Category Manager, establish inventory flow which supports demand and inventory targets; align on optimal units/style
  • Validate promotional marketing plan aligns to monthly financial plan
  • 40%:
    In-Season Management

  • Execute monthly/as needed re-forecast of comprehensive financial plans; re-forecast sales, margin, and inventory based on trend to identify risks/opportunities compared to plan
  • Develop and execute markdown strategies to achieve unit sales plan while maximizing margin
  • Partner with the Category Manager to provide strong in-season forecasts and develop corrective in-season actions where required
  • Conduct post-season analysis and draft monthly/quarterly hindsight recaps and strategies for the next season buys
  • 15%:
    Reporting and Analysis

  • Determine sizing requirements by commodity based on pre-season performance analysis
  • Provide ad hoc business reports and analysis as needed
  • Utilize company-approved tools and processes to support planning and measurement of the business
